Set against the backdrop of Japan’s imperial court, the novel follows Haruko, a woman of good family who becomes the first non-aristocratic consort of the Crown Prince, facing cruelty and suspicion as she navigates her new life. Through her journey—from marriage and motherhood to eventual empress—she endures personal and political challenges that shape her story over three decades. Narrated in Haruko’s voice, the book explores themes of power, resilience, and complex relationships within a highly secretive monarchy. Written by John Burnham Schwartz, it offers a compelling and meticulously researched portrayal of an extraordinary life.
